      Section: 55:14k-32: Pledge, covenant and agreement of state with bondholders

           The State of New Jersey does hereby pledge to and covenant and agree with the holders of any bonds issued pursuant to the authority of this act that the State will not limit, restrict or alter the rights or powers hereby vested in the agency to perform and fulfill the terms of any agreement made with the holders of such bonds, or in any way impair the rights or remedies of such holders until such bonds, together with interest thereon, with interest on any unpaid installments of interest, and all costs and expenses in connection with any action or proceedings by or in behalf of such holders, are fully met, paid and discharged. The agency may include this pledge and agreement of the State in any agreement with the holders of bonds issued by the agency.

L.1983, c. 530, s. 32, eff. Jan. 17, 1984.
